68static int
69generate_key(DH *dh)
70{
71 int ok = 0;
72 unsigned l;
73 BN_CTX *ctx;
74 BN_MONT_CTX *mont = NULL;
75 BIGNUM *pub_key = NULL, *priv_key = NULL;
76
77 if (BN_num_bits(dh->p) > OPENSSL_DH_MAX_MODULUS_BITS) {
78 DHerror(DH_R_MODULUS_TOO_LARGE);
79 return 0;
80 }
81
82 ctx = BN_CTX_new();
83 if (ctx == NULL)
84 goto err;
85
86 if ((priv_key = dh->priv_key) == NULL) {
87 if ((priv_key = BN_new()) == NULL)
88 goto err;
89 }
90
91 if ((pub_key = dh->pub_key) == NULL) {
92 if ((pub_key = BN_new()) == NULL)
93 goto err;
94 }
95
96 if (dh->flags & DH_FLAG_CACHE_MONT_P) {
97 mont = BN_MONT_CTX_set_locked(&dh->method_mont_p,
98 CRYPTO_LOCK_DH, dh->p, ctx);
99 if (!mont)
100 goto err;
101 }
102
103 if (dh->priv_key == NULL) {
104 if (dh->q) {
105 if (!bn_rand_interval(priv_key, 2, dh->q))
106 goto err;
107 } else {
108 /* secret exponent length */
109 l = dh->length ? dh->length : BN_num_bits(dh->p) - 1;
110 if (!BN_rand(priv_key, l, 0, 0))
111 goto err;
112 }
113 }
114
115 if (!dh->meth->bn_mod_exp(dh, pub_key, dh->g, priv_key, dh->p, ctx,
116 mont))
117 goto err;
118
119 dh->pub_key = pub_key;
120 dh->priv_key = priv_key;
121 ok = 1;
122 err:
123 if (ok != 1)
124 DHerror(ERR_R_BN_LIB);
125
126 if (dh->pub_key == NULL)
127 BN_free(pub_key);
128 if (dh->priv_key == NULL)
129 BN_free(priv_key);
130 BN_CTX_free(ctx);
131
132 return ok;
133}

135static int
136compute_key(unsigned char *key, const BIGNUM *pub_key, DH *dh)
137{
138 BN_CTX *ctx = NULL;
139 BN_MONT_CTX *mont = NULL;
140 BIGNUM *tmp;
141 int ret = -1;
142 int check_result;
143
144 if (BN_num_bits(dh->p) > OPENSSL_DH_MAX_MODULUS_BITS) {
145 DHerror(DH_R_MODULUS_TOO_LARGE);
146 goto err;
147 }
148
149 ctx = BN_CTX_new();
150 if (ctx == NULL)
151 goto err;
152 BN_CTX_start(ctx);
153 if ((tmp = BN_CTX_get(ctx)) == NULL)
154 goto err;
155
156 if (dh->priv_key == NULL) {
157 DHerror(DH_R_NO_PRIVATE_VALUE);
158 goto err;
159 }
160
161 if (dh->flags & DH_FLAG_CACHE_MONT_P) {
162 mont = BN_MONT_CTX_set_locked(&dh->method_mont_p,
163 CRYPTO_LOCK_DH, dh->p, ctx);
164
165 BN_set_flags(dh->priv_key, BN_FLG_CONSTTIME);
166
167 if (!mont)
168 goto err;
169 }
170
171 if (!DH_check_pub_key(dh, pub_key, &check_result) || check_result) {
172 DHerror(DH_R_INVALID_PUBKEY);
173 goto err;
174 }
175
176 if (!dh->meth->bn_mod_exp(dh, tmp, pub_key, dh->priv_key, dh->p, ctx,
177 mont)) {
178 DHerror(ERR_R_BN_LIB);
179 goto err;
180 }
181
182 ret = BN_bn2bin(tmp, key);
183 err:
184 if (ctx != NULL) {
185 BN_CTX_end(ctx);
186 BN_CTX_free(ctx);
187 }
188 return ret;
189}
